Associate Software Engineer applicants have rated the interview process at Accenture with 2.4 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 81% positive. To compare, the company-average is 72.4%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Associate Software Engineer roles take an average of 19 days to get hired, when considering 3,353 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Accenture overall takes an average of 26 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Accenture as a Associate Software Engineer according to 3,353 Glassdoor interviews include:
One on one interview: 17%
Skills test: 16%
Personality test: 12%
Group panel interview: 11%
Presentation: 11%
IQ intelligence test: 10%
Background check: 10%
Phone interview: 7%
Other: 4%
Drug test: 3%

I applied through university. The process took 2 months. I interviewed at Accenture (Bengaluru) in Aug 2023
Interview
4 rounds of interview.
1. Aptitude, reasoning and technical mcqs
2. Coding round - two questions. You are kept in dark about test cases passed. Only after finishing exam you will know it.
3. Communication round - listening, speaking, reading skills through online.
4. Interview - Technical + HR. Easy questions generally related to academics and behavioral and projects.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
What do you do when conflict arises in team work? What subject is your favorite and why?
I was interviewed in the Mandaluyong site. It was before the pandemic, so the interview was held in person. I had a one-on-one interview with one of the recruiters. The interview questions were average.
It was very structured. It consisted of 1 round. The interviewer asked me to introduce myself and then asked questions on my resume. They are basically looking for candidates to walk through their resume. They didn't ask any question apart from the resume
The process was 1 online assessment and 1 group interview with 3 panelists. They asked both technical and soft skills questions. Each interviewer asked different questions. The total interview was less than 30 mins.
